2018 Henty Farm Pinot Noir
Wine Rating
93
The cool climate site of Henty is the home of some great vineyards and is one of the premium, but less known regions for Pinot Noir in Victoria.
A vibrant but light red in the glass with a nose of rhubarb and red cherry alongside delicate spice. The palate has a baseline of sappy red cherry fruit and richer plum before a weave of spice and textural acidity pulls things together. Very good length and value.
